[netfilter-cvslog] r3338 - in trunk/nfsim: core kernelenv/include

rusty at netfilter.org rusty at netfilter.org
Mon Dec 13 05:11:28 CET 2004


Author: rusty at netfilter.org
Date: 2004-12-13 05:11:27 +0100 (Mon, 13 Dec 2004)
New Revision: 3338

Modified:
   trunk/nfsim/core/core.h
   trunk/nfsim/kernelenv/include/kernelenv.h
Log:
Handle ip_ct_attach in kernelenv.h, not core.h and kernelenv.h.


Modified: trunk/nfsim/core/core.h
===================================================================
--- trunk/nfsim/core/core.h	2004-12-13 04:06:11 UTC (rev 3337)
+++ trunk/nfsim/core/core.h	2004-12-13 04:11:27 UTC (rev 3338)
@@ -211,12 +211,6 @@
 
 #include <ipv4/ipv4.h>
 
-#if LINUX_VERSION_CODE < KERNEL_VERSION(2,6,9)
-void (*ip_ct_attach)(struct sk_buff *, struct nf_ct_info *);
-#else
-void (*ip_ct_attach)(struct sk_buff *, struct sk_buff *);
-#endif
-
 void stop(void);
 
 static inline int complete_read(int fd, char *buf, int len)

Modified: trunk/nfsim/kernelenv/include/kernelenv.h
===================================================================
--- trunk/nfsim/kernelenv/include/kernelenv.h	2004-12-13 04:06:11 UTC (rev 3337)
+++ trunk/nfsim/kernelenv/include/kernelenv.h	2004-12-13 04:11:27 UTC (rev 3338)
@@ -483,6 +483,7 @@
 	if (nfct)
 		atomic_inc(&nfct->master->use);
 }
+void (*ip_ct_attach)(struct sk_buff *, struct nf_ct_info *);
 #else
 static inline void nf_conntrack_put(struct nf_conntrack *nfct)
 {
@@ -508,9 +509,9 @@
 	skb->nf_debug = 0;
 #endif
 }
+void (*ip_ct_attach)(struct sk_buff *, struct sk_buff *);
 #endif /* 2.6.9 */
 
-extern void (*ip_ct_attach)(struct sk_buff *, struct sk_buff *);
 extern void nf_ct_attach(struct sk_buff *, struct sk_buff *);
 
 struct sk_buff *alloc_skb(unsigned int size, int gfp_mask);




More information about the netfilter-cvslog mailing list